iciHaiti - Education : Fruitful discussions with the French Ambassador

Augustin Antoine Minister of National Education, accompanied by Professor Jean-Robert Dossaint, Director of the Minister's Office; Miguel Fleurijean, Director of Secondary Education and Étienne Louisseul France, Departmental Director of Education of the West received this week Antoine Michon the Ambassador of France accredited to Haiti who was accompanied by Bertrand Ollivier, Political Advisor at the Embassy.

In order to frame this conversation, Minister Antoine elaborated on some priority projects such as : the strengthening of preschool, the improvement of the quality of public education, multilingualism based on the mother tongue, the introduction of four new subjects in the fundamental (Education in technology and productive activities, Aesthetic and artistic education, Physical and sports education, Education in citizenship), the development of the technological sector of the renovated secondary school and the increase in the offer of the school canteen.

On the educational projects, Minister Antoine and Ambassador Michon shared their points of view on the need to ensure teacher training, the development and popularization of revised school programs in order to support the transformation of education in Haiti, which must be more connected to the needs of society.

Furthermore, Ambassador Michon reported on a fund of several million euros that will be injected into the school canteen during the 2024-2025 academic year, in accordance with the strategy of the Haitian State which wishes to increase the share of consumption of local agricultural products in schools.

In the very short term, French cooperation also plans to provide financial support for the rehabilitation of certain public school infrastructures in the metropolitan region of Port-au-Prince.

This first meeting between Minister Antoine and the French Ambassador made it possible to explore other areas of educational partnership.
